Defining game mechanics and their role in player engagement<\/h3>\n<p style=\"margin-bottom: 15px;\">Game mechanics are the rules and systems that define how players interact with a game environment. They include elements like scoring systems, level progression, reward structures, and decision points. These mechanics are crucial for maintaining player engagement, as they create a sense of challenge, mastery, and anticipation. For example, in slot games, mechanics such as symbol combinations, bonus rounds, and progressive jackpots motivate players to continue playing by offering clear goals and rewards.<\/p>\n<h3 style=\"font-family: Arial, sans-serif; font-size: 1.5em; color: #34495e; margin-top: 30px; margin-bottom: 10px;\">b. The evolution of game mechanics in digital entertainment<\/h3>\n<p style=\"margin-bottom: 15px;\">From simple score counters in early arcade games to complex multi-layered systems in modern online games, mechanics have evolved significantly. Innovations such as loot boxes, skill trees, and adaptive difficulty not only enhance player experience but also influence game design paradigms. This evolution reflects a broader trend: mechanics serve as a foundation for creating immersive and personalized experiences, which modern digital products increasingly adopt.<\/p>\n<h3 style=\"font-family: Arial, sans-serif; font-size: 1.5em; color: #34495e; margin-top: 30px; margin-bottom: 10px;\">c. Overview of how mechanics influence modern design principles<\/h3>\n<p style=\"margin-bottom: 15px;\">Mechanics inform core design principles like usability, flow, and motivation. They guide how interfaces are structured, how feedback is delivered, and how users are incentivized to engage. For instance, reward systems can foster a sense of achievement, encouraging continued interaction. Recognizing this influence allows designers to craft products that are not only functional but also captivating and intuitively understandable.<\/p>\n<h2 id=\"educational-core\" style=\"font-family: Arial, sans-serif; font-size: 2em; color: #2c3e50; margin-top: 40px; margin-bottom: 15px;\">2. How game mechanics serve as instructional tools for designers<\/h3>\n<p style=\"margin-bottom: 15px;\">Game mechanics act as a practical language for designers, providing a structured way to create engaging experiences. By experimenting with mechanics like variable rewards or risk-reward balances, designers learn how to influence user behavior and sustain interest. These systems serve as a sandbox for understanding user motivation and behavior patterns, which can then be applied to non-gaming contexts such as educational platforms or marketing tools.<\/p>\n<h3 style=\"font-family: Arial, sans-serif; font-size: 1.5em; color: #34495e; margin-top: 30px; margin-bottom: 10px;\">b. The transfer of mechanics from entertainment to innovative applications<\/h3>\n<p style=\"margin-bottom: 15px;\">Mechanics originally designed for entertainment are increasingly adapted for purposes like employee training, health apps, and gamified learning. For example, progress bars and achievement badges\u2014common in games\u2014are now used in educational apps to motivate learners. This transfer demonstrates that core mechanics can be powerful tools for driving engagement and behavior change beyond entertainment.<\/p>\n<h3 style=\"font-family: Arial, sans-serif; font-size: 1.5em; color: #34495e; margin-top: 30px; margin-bottom: 10px;\">c. Examples of mechanics fostering strategic thinking and problem-solving<\/h3>\n<p style=\"margin-bottom: 15px;\">Consider mechanics such as resource management, multi-step decision trees, and adaptive challenges. These elements push users to think critically and develop strategies. For instance, puzzle games like Sudoku or strategy apps incorporate mechanics that require planning and foresight. Such features are increasingly used in educational settings to promote cognitive skills, illustrating how game mechanics foster valuable real-world skills.<\/p>\n<h2 id=\"progression-rewards\" style=\"font-family: Arial, sans-serif; font-size: 2em; color: #2c3e50; margin-top: 40px; margin-bottom: 15px;\">3. The importance of progression systems in maintaining player interest<\/h3>\n<p style=\"margin-bottom: 15px;\">Progression systems\u2014such as levels, unlocks, or skill trees\u2014are vital for sustaining long-term engagement. They create a sense of growth and achievement, encouraging players to invest time and effort. In the context of modern design, these systems translate into user onboarding flows, feature unlocks, or content tiers that motivate continued interaction.<\/p>\n<h3 style=\"font-family: Arial, sans-serif; font-size: 1.5em; color: #34495e; margin-top: 30px; margin-bottom: 10px;\">b. Rewards and incentives: symbols, bonuses, and transformations as motivators<\/h3>\n<p style=\"margin-bottom: 15px;\">Rewards serve as tangible markers of progress, triggering dopamine responses that reinforce engagement. Symbols like coins, wilds, or bonus icons in slot games act as visual cues for potential gains. Transformations\u2014such as symbol upgrades or multipliers\u2014add layers of excitement, turning simple rewards into complex motivational systems.<\/p>\n<h3 style=\"font-family: Arial, sans-serif; font-size: 1.5em; color: #34495e; margin-top: 30px; margin-bottom: 10px;\">c. Types of bonus games: regular and super bonus modes<\/h3>\n<p style=\"margin-bottom: 15px;\">Bonus games come in various forms, from triggered mini-games to elaborate special modes. Regular bonuses might include free spins or pick-and-win features, while super bonus modes offer multi-stage challenges with higher stakes. These mechanics diversify gameplay, keeping players engaged and eager to discover new features.<\/p>\n<h3 style=\"font-family: Arial, sans-serif; font-size: 1.5em; color: #34495e; margin-top: 30px; margin-bottom: 10px;\">b. Retained progression within bonus rounds and its psychological impact<\/h3>\n<p style=\"margin-bottom: 15px;\">Retention mechanics, such as accumulating multipliers or unlocking new features during bonus rounds, deepen engagement. They tap into players\u2019 desire for mastery and control, encouraging sustained participation. This psychological aspect is a core principle in designing mechanics that foster long-term loyalty.<\/p>\n<h3 style=\"font-family: Arial, sans-serif; font-size: 1.5em; color: #34495e; margin-top: 30px; margin-bottom: 10px;\">c.
